Output 18bd93e1429e59f846432a70f75bfdcb8bcd82b29acdb232ffe388bec178386d:0

value
70375685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 691e89d3bfdb2643c2ec3fa99737dda323483f3b OP_EQUAL
address
3BGqTXiAcj3Jfy4ECJ7udsp7Mi9QJB3G5m
transaction
18bd93e1429e59f846432a70f75bfdcb8bcd82b29acdb232ffe388bec178386d
spent
true